Competitive Gaming: Esports Phenomenon

The rise of esports has propelled online gaming into the realm of professional competition, turning what was once a casual pastime into a billion-dollar industry. Games like League of Legends, Dota 2, and Counter-Strike: Global Offensive have become synonymous with competitive gaming, attracting massive audiences to tournaments and championships held worldwide.

Professional gamers, once relegated to the fringes of mainstream entertainment, are now celebrated athletes with dedicated fan bases. Esports events fill arenas, and online streaming platforms broadcast matches to millions, demonstrating the growing influence of competitive gaming in the broader cultural landscape.

Technological Advancements: Pushing the Boundaries

The development of online games has been closely intertwined with technological progress. As hardware capabilities have expanded, so too have the possibilities for game developers. The transition from text-based adventures to graphically rich, three-dimensional worlds has been nothing short of revolutionary.

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) have added new dimensions to online gaming, offering players immersive experiences that blur the lines between the virtual and physical realms. Games like Beat Saber in VR and Pokémon GO in AR showcase the potential for these technologies to redefine how we interact with digital entertainment.
